Construye tu primer programa sencillo

Tema elegido: Construir tu primer programa sencillo. Bienvenido a un viaje cercano, práctico y emocionante para dar tus primeros pasos en programación. Aquí aprenderás sin miedo, con ejemplos reales y pequeños triunfos que te motivarán a seguir. ¿Listo para escribir tu primera línea y sonreír cuando funcione?

El primer paso: lenguaje y herramientas sin complicaciones

Por qué empezar con Python o JavaScript

Python y JavaScript son amigables para principiantes, tienen una comunidad enorme y ejemplos por todas partes. Te permiten ver resultados rápido, entender conceptos esenciales y evitar distracciones complejas mientras construyes tu primer programa sencillo.

Instalando tu entorno de desarrollo sin miedo

Descarga un editor como VS Code, instala el lenguaje elegido y prueba el botón de ejecutar. No busques la perfección técnica hoy; busca un camino claro para escribir, guardar y ver tu programa funcionando.

Tu primer archivo y el mágico ‘Hola, mundo’

Crea un archivo con un nombre claro y escribe la línea que imprime ‘Hola, mundo’. Al verlo en pantalla, sentirás esa chispa: tu idea viajó del teclado a la realidad. Celebra y cuéntanos cómo te fue.

Pensar como programador: de la idea a pasos pequeños

Define el objetivo con una sola frase

Escribe qué debe hacer tu programa en una línea clara, por ejemplo: “Pedir un nombre y saludar”. Esa frase guía cada decisión, evita distracciones y te recuerda que la simpleza es un triunfo.

Divide en acciones concretas

Transforma la idea en pasos: pedir datos, procesarlos y mostrar un resultado. Así reduces el miedo, previenes bloqueos y creas una ruta que puedes implementar y comprobar paso a paso sin abrumarte.

Una mini historia para inspirarte

Lucía quiso un programa que recomendara una canción alegre. Empezó pidiendo el estado de ánimo, luego eligió un mensaje según la respuesta, y al final mostró un enlace. Tres pasos, un resultado encantador.

Entrada y salida: conversar con tu programa

Muestra un mensaje claro, explica lo que esperas y da un ejemplo. Cuando el usuario entiende, tu programa brilla. Incluso tú, como autor, te sentirás guiado mientras pruebas y ajustas.

Control de flujo: decisiones y repeticiones esenciales

Condiciones que cambian el camino

Con una condición, tu programa puede saludar de forma distinta según la hora o validar que el usuario escribió algo. Es el primer paso para sentir la lógica viviendo dentro de tu código.

Bucles con propósito y límites claros

Usa bucles para repetir preguntas hasta recibir datos válidos. Establece condiciones de salida visibles para evitar repeticiones infinitas. Empieza simple, prueba casos extremos y observa cómo responde tu programa.

Lección de un error común

Ana olvidó actualizar un contador y su bucle no terminó. En lugar de frustrarse, imprimió valores intermedios, encontró la causa y aprendió a celebrar cada avance. La depuración también es aprendizaje.

Errores sin drama: depurar como explorador

Identifica el archivo, la línea y el tipo de error. Muchas veces, la solución está en el texto. Copia fragmentos y busca referencias. Es normal equivocarse; tu primer programa sencillo te lo enseñará.

Errores sin drama: depurar como explorador

Inserta impresiones temporales para ver valores y el orden de ejecución. Ver lo invisible te ayuda a entender qué ocurre realmente y dónde ajustar sin perderte en suposiciones.

Guardar y compartir: control de versiones básico

Inicializa un repositorio, realiza tu primer commit con un mensaje claro y entiende que cada cambio cuenta una historia. Te ayudará a volver atrás y a aprender de tu propio progreso.

Guardar y compartir: control de versiones básico

Crea un repositorio remoto, súbelo y comparte el enlace. Invita a amigos a probarlo y comentar. El aprendizaje se multiplica cuando otros miran tu trabajo con ojos frescos y curiosos.

Guardar y compartir: control de versiones básico

Suscríbete para recibir guías sencillas, retos semanales y ejemplos listos para adaptar. Cuéntanos en los comentarios qué programa construiste hoy y qué te gustaría aprender en la próxima entrega.
Divorceperfumes
Privacy Overview

This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.